Uma Mainnet é uma rede digital distribuída e operacional que serve oficialmente como a infraestrutura primária para uma criptomoeda específica. O lan?amento de uma rede principal é um marco crítico para qualquer projeto de blockchain, porque significa que o projeto está pronto para uso público e transa??es no mundo real.
Como funcionam uma Mainnet?
O código do projeto Blockchain é inicialmente lan?ado em um ambiente de teste chamado testnet. O ambiente em sandbox permite que os desenvolvedores de projetos testem novos códigos e ajustem a lógica para atualiza??es e bifurca??es de projetos sem afetar a rede principal ativa. Depois que o código passa pela garantia de qualidade (QA) no ambiente de preparo, ele é migrado para o ambiente de produ??o da rede principal e disponibilizado para uso público.
Quando um usuário inicia uma transa??o na rede, ela é transmitida para os nodes da rede. Os mineradores ent?o competem para adicionar a transa??o ao próximo bloco no blockchain, resolvendo quebra-cabe?as matemáticos complexos. O primeiro minerador a resolver o quebra-cabe?a e adicionar a transa??o ao blockchain é recompensado com uma quantidade definida de criptomoeda. é isso que incentiva os mineradores a participar do processo.
Os Componentes da Mainnet
As Mainnet (redes principais) s?o compostas por nodes de computa??o distribuídos que se conectam para formar uma rede ponto a ponto (P2P) para uma criptomoeda específica.
Os componentes da Mainnet incluem nodes de rede, uma criptomoeda que fornece incentivos econ?micos para os usuários apoiarem a rede, um mecanismo de consenso que permite que os nodes verifiquem e validem transa??es e blocos de armazenamento que est?o ligados para formar uma cadeia – daí o nome blockchain.
Mainnet Nodes: Os nodes s?o os computadores ou servidores individuais que formam uma rede principal de criptografia. As Mainnet de criptomoedas dependem da participa??o ativa de nodes de rede que s?o incentivados por recompensas financeiras a verificar, processar, validar e registrar as transa??es do usuário.
Os nodes podem ser categorizados de duas maneiras:
A maioria das mainnet é projetada para acomodar nodes completos e light nodes para otimizar o desempenho da rede e encontrar um equilíbrio entre a necessidade de descentraliza??o, seguran?a e escalabilidade. Algumas mainnet como Ethereum e Binance Smart Chain, no entanto, se beneficiam de ter um número maior de nodes completos para oferecer suporte a contratos inteligentes e aplicativos descentralizados (dApps).
Criptomoeda: A maioria das mainnet tem sua própria criptomoeda nativa para oferecer suporte a transa??es e recompensar os mineradores, validadores e stakers que contribuem com seus recursos e poder computacional para manter a rede, validar transa??es e manter a rede principal segura.
Mecanismo de consenso: Um mecanismo de consenso é um conjunto de regras que regem como as transa??es s?o validadas e registradas em um blockchain. Os mecanismos de consenso mais comuns s?o Proof of Work (PoW) e Proof of Stake (PoS). Os mecanismos de consenso garantem que apenas transa??es válidas sejam adicionadas ao blockchain da rede principal.
Blocos: Um bloco é uma unidade de armazenamento de dados. Cada bloco em uma rede principal armazena uma cole??o de transa??es, um carimbo de data/hora e um hash criptográfico que faz referência ao bloco anterior na cadeia. Os blocos vinculados criam um registro seguro, cronológico e inviolável de todas as transa??es que ocorreram na rede.
Papel dos mineradores em uma Mainnet de criptomoedas
Os mineradores desempenham um papel crucial na manuten??o da integridade e seguran?a de uma mainnet de criptomoedas. Os mineradores s?o nodes de computador na rede que usam seu poder computacional para verificar e validar transa??es no blockchain. Algumas criptomoedas permitem apenas que nodes completos participem da minera??o, enquanto outras permitem a minera??o de light nodes.
Além de adicionar novos blocos ao blockchain, os mineradores também verificam a validade dos blocos anteriores cada vez que um novo bloco é adicionado à cadeia. Esse processo é importante porque garante que o blockchain seja seguro e que as transa??es registradas no blockchain sejam imutáveis.
Os mineradores de criptomoedas foram culpados por contribuir para o aquecimento global porque é necessária uma quantidade significativa de energia para alimentar as opera??es de minera??o. As preocupa??es com o impacto ambiental da minera??o de criptomoedas levaram a pedidos de plataformas de minera??o mais eficientes em termos de energia e ao uso de fontes de energia renováveis.
Exemplos de lan?amentos bem-sucedidos de mainnet de criptomoedas?
Aqui est?o alguns exemplos de lan?amentos de mainnet de criptomoedas que causaram um impacto significativo no ecossistema blockchain.
Bitcoin?
Em 2009, o lan?amento da rede principal do Bitcoin marcou o início da era blockchain e apresentou ao mundo as moedas digitais descentralizadas e a tecnologia subjacente que as alimenta. A rede Bitcoin, que usa o mecanismo de consenso Proof of Work, tem funcionado sem problemas desde o seu início e, sem dúvida, serve como a espinha dorsal de todo o ecossistema de criptomoedas.
Ethereum?
Em 2015, o lan?amento da mainnet Ethereum abriu caminho para vários projetos inovadores de blockchain e promoveu a inova??o para o uso de dApps e contratos inteligentes. Desde ent?o, a mainnet do Ethereum passou por várias atualiza??es e pelo menos dois forks, incluindo os hard forks Byzantium e Constantinople. A próxima mainnet Ethereum (Etherium 2.0) é atualmente uma rede de teste que substitui o mecanismo de consenso PoW da Ethereum por Proof of Stake (PoS).
Binance?
Em setembro de 2020, a Binance, uma das maiores exchanges de criptomoedas do mundo, lan?ou a Binance Smart Chain (BSC), uma blockchain paralela à Binance Chain que oferece suporte a contratos inteligentes e dApps. O lan?amento da mainnet? da BSC teve como objetivo fornecer uma plataforma mais eficiente e escalável para aplicativos de finan?as descentralizadas (DeFi), com tempos de transa??o mais rápidos e taxas mais baixas em compara??o com o Ethereum. A BSC teve sucesso em atrair vários projetos DeFi, solidificando sua posi??o como uma mainnet proeminente no ecossistema DeFi.
Solana?
A mainnet Solana, também lan?ada em 2020, visa oferecer velocidades de transa??o rápidas e alto rendimento, aproveitando um novo mecanismo de consenso chamado Proof of History (PoH). Desde o lan?amento da mainnet, Solana atraiu vários projetos DeFi, plataformas NFT e até moedas meme baseadas em Solana, tornando-se uma das redes blockchain de crescimento mais rápido do setor.